ssh的三个强大的端口转发命令: [color="#000000"]QUOTE: ssh -C -f -N -g -L listen_port:DST_Host:DST_port user@tunnel_Host ssh -C -f -N -g -R listen_port:DST_Host:DST_port user@tunnel_Host ssh -C -f -N -g -D listen_port user@tunnel_Host -f Fork into background after authentication. 后台认证用户/密码,通常和-N连用,不用登录到远程主机。 -p port Connect to this port. Server must be ...
by lsstarboy - 网络技术文档中心 - 2009-01-14 22:29:27 阅读(1210) 回复(0)
我从 local 的 A(192.192.192.192)机器无法 telnet 远程的 C(10.10.10.10)机器,现在通过 B(20.20.20.20)机器作端口转发,如下: 终端1: A# ssh -v -g -L 9000:10.10.10.10:9000 -l root 20.20.20.20 终端2: A# telnet localhost 9000 这样我就现实了从A到C的telnet. 但我想从A ssh到C,如下: 终端1: A# ssh -v -g -L 9000:10.10.10.10:9000 -l root 20.20.20.20 终端2: A# ssh -l user localhost -p 9000 出问题了, 终端2挂在那里,没...
比如192.168.0.1这台服务器只开了22这个端口,而且我想通过ssh来远程管理192.168.0.1这台服务器的图形界面 ssh -L 3389:192.168.0.1:3389 username@192.16.0.1 命令是这样吧
最近遇到了一组机器,拿到了一台FreeBSD的root权限,root权限是通过webshell返回的反弹端口拿到的。 远程不让访问,这组机器的另外一台机器拿到了nobody权限,但是通过仔细的观察发现,拿到root权限的FreeBSD直接用ssh不用密码就能直接连接上nobody的FreeBSD机器。但是由于的反弹回来的shell,是不能用ssh直接连接的,上面提示是说不是一个真实的TTY端。 我想让各位高手解决的问题就是在root权限的机器上做一个代理,然后利用...
本人用 ssh 建立了一條 tunnel [code]e.g. ssh -L6666:211.211.211.211:80 211.211.211.211 [/code] 這樣我便可以經過本機的 127.0.0.1 port 6666 連到 211.211.211.211:80 [code]e.g. telnet 127.0.0.1 6666 connectd 127.0.0.1[/code] 但現在使用 iptables 想把這個 127.0.0.1 的 port 6666 轉到 eth0 的 port 6667 上 可以讓其他機器連到這台機器上的 eth0 的 port 6667 取得好像 telnet 127.0.0.1 6666 的結果......
我已经在vi /etc/ssh/sshd_config 下将port 改为1500 而且1500没有提供任何的服务。 /etc/rc.d/init.d/sshd restart 我在INPUT链中开启了这个端口 iptables -I INPUT 2 -p tcp --dport 1500 -j ACCEPT /etc/rc.d/init.d/iptables save 我还是登陆不上去 当我把iptables STOP了,我登陆的时候还是只能用22。到底是哪个地方没有设置好啊